Understanding Layer 2 Solutions in Blockchain Technology
In the realm of blockchain technology, scalability has long been a pressing issue, particularly for networks like Ethereum. As user demand surged, transaction fees skyrocketed, and processing times slowed down significantly. This challenge led to the emergence of Layer 2 solutions, a suite of technologies designed to enhance network efficiency and scalability by operating above the base layer (Layer 1).
The Genesis of Layer 2 Solutions
Layer 2 solutions serve as secondary layers built atop the primary blockchain network. Their primary objective is to alleviate congestion on the main chain by executing transactions off-chain and settling them on-chain when necessary. By doing so, these solutions aim to reduce transaction costs, increase throughput, and enhance overall network performance.
Diving into Technologies Under Layer 2 Solutions
Several technologies fall under the umbrella of Layer 2 solutions:
- Off-chain transactions: Transactions processed outside the main blockchain.
- State channels: Temporary off-chain channels facilitating continuous transactions without constant updates to the main chain.
- Rollups: Aggregating multiple transactions into a single one for processing on the main chain.
- Sidechains: Separate blockchains connected to the main chain via bridges for more efficient processing.

Navigating Potential Challenges
While Layer 2 solutions offer promising scalability enhancements, they also introduce new challenges:
- Security Risks: Compromised off-chain transactions could potentially impact main chain integrity.
- Interoperability Issues: Incompatibility between different solutions may lead to fragmentation within networks.
- Regulatory Challenges: Evolving regulatory frameworks may need adjustments due to decentralized nature of off-chain transactions.
